The NetBeacon Institute (formerly the DNS Abuse Institute) was created by PIR to develop initiatives to generate recommended practices, foster collaboration, and find industry-shared solutions to combat malware, botnets, phishing, pharming, and related spam.[1]

As DNS Abuse Institute

Founded in 2021 in furtherance of PIR’s nonprofit mission.

As NetBeacon Institute

The Institute was renamed in 2024 to the NetBeacon Institute. [2]
